<h2>Traditional Japanese Tattoo Coloring Techniques</h2>
The foundation of Japanese tattoo coloring lies in natural pigments and hand-poked methods using fine tools like the tebori needle. Artists apply mineral-based dyes—such as indigo, cinnabar, and iron oxide—blended to enhance depth and cultural authenticity. Each color carries meaning: red signifies protection, black embodies strength, and gold denotes reverence.
<h2>Symbolism in Modern Japanese Tattoo Coloring</h2>
Modern interpretations blend ancestral wisdom with vibrant palettes, often incorporating floral elements like cherry blossoms, dragons, and koi fish. Coloring choices reflect personal identity and storytelling, where shades are layered to create dynamic visual impact while honoring time-honored traditions.
